What Is a Legal Video Clip Deposition?
A lawful video deposition is a taped testament taken from a witness under oath, normally conducted outside of the court. This procedure records both the non-verbal and verbal feedbacks of the witness, providing a complete account of their declarations. Legal video depositions serve multiple functions in lawsuits, consisting of preserving a witness's testimony for later use in court, evaluating the trustworthiness of the witness, and assisting in negotiation conversations. They are typically made use of in civil instances, particularly in injury or contract disputes, where witness accounts can substantially influence the end result. The visibility of a court press reporter assurances that a verbatim transcript goes along with the video recording, preserving a trusted record of the proceedings. Lawful video clip depositions are an essential tool for lawyers, supplying a vibrant means to existing proof and examine the staminas and weak points of a situation before it reaches test.

Tools and Arrangement
While planning for a video deposition, focus to tools and arrangement is crucial for recording clear and reputable video footage. The main components consist of top quality video cameras, microphones, and illumination systems. Video cameras must can videotaping in hd to guarantee that every information shows up. Professional-grade microphones, ideally lavalier or shotgun kinds, improve audio clearness by reducing history sound. Correct illumination is vital; soft, diffused light helps avoid rough darkness and improves facial presence. In addition, steady tripods are required to avoid camera shake. A devoted area, devoid of distractions, better improves the quality of the deposition. Verifying that all equipment is tested before the session guarantees a smooth recording experience, adding to the integrity of the lawful process.

Exactly How Video Clip Depositions Are Utilized in Court
The prep work and execution of a video clip deposition play a significant function in how these recordings are used during court procedures. Video clip depositions serve as vital proof, allowing courts and judges to observe the attitude and trustworthiness of witnesses. They make it possible for the court to examine non-verbal cues, such as body movement and tone, which are frequently crucial in determining the integrity of testament. Additionally, video depositions can be made use of to refresh a witness's memory or to challenge irregular declarations made during trial. In many cases, they may replace the requirement for real-time testimony, specifically when a witness is incapable or inaccessible to go to court. Courts frequently confess these recordings as part of the proof, giving a detailed view of the witness's statements. Generally, their aesthetic part boosts the understanding of testament, making video clip depositions an indispensable device in lawful procedures.

Technical Arrangement Guidelines
While planning for a video deposition, assuring a trusted technical arrangement is vital for both lawyers and customers. Initially, a quiet, well-lit area needs to be selected, cost-free from interruptions and disturbances. The camera ought to be positioned at eye degree to develop an all-natural viewing angle, while the microphone should be put close enough to catch clear sound. Testing the equipment, including video and audio high quality, before the deposition is essential. Attorneys and clients should confirm their web link is steady to prevent interruptions. In addition, it is advisable to have backup devices prepared in situation of technical failures. Acquainting oneself with the video conferencing platform can additionally improve the overall experience, causing a smoother deposition process.
